DigitalOcean is a cloud service provider known for its IaaS and PaaS solutions, focusing on developer support and easy workflows.
Launched in 2012, DigitalOcean aims to simplify and make the cloud cost-effective for developers.
Its data centers are mainly in North America, Western Europe, Southeast Asia, and Oceania, offering low latency for users nearby.
While developers and small businesses are its primary targets, large organizations can use DigitalOcean in multi-cloud or hybrid cloud setups.
Despite having fewer services and limited global presence, DigitalOcean is favored by developers and SMBs for its simplicity and cost-effectiveness.
DigitalOcean Droplets are virtual servers supporting only Linux, equivalent to EC2 on AWS and Azure Virtual Machines.
DigitalOcean Droplet plans cater to different needs, such as basic, general purpose, CPU-optimized, memory-optimized, and storage-optimized.
Use cases for DigitalOcean include real-time data analysis, web and database servers, app development, AI, IoT, video hosting, and cloud security.
In addition to Droplets, DigitalOcean offers services like App Platform, Functions, Cloud Firewalls, Kubernetes, Load Balancers, and managed databases.
Key benefits of DigitalOcean include ease of use, developer-friendliness, affordability, well-documented APIs, and a strong community.